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/bredah/testedesoftware-javascript
https://github.com/bredah/testedesoftware-javascript
Last synced: about 1 month ago
JSON representation
- Host: GitHub
- URL: https://github.com/bredah/testedesoftware-javascript
- Owner: bredah
- Created: 2024-08-20T18:49:09.000Z (5 months ago)
- Default Branch: main
- Last Pushed: 2024-08-26T19:45:56.000Z (5 months ago)
- Last Synced: 2024-08-27T22:49:55.362Z (5 months ago)
- Size: 1.16 MB
- Stars: 0
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
# Teste de Software - API REST utilizando NodeJS
## requisitos
### 01 . Gerenciar mensagens do usuário
#### Requesito Funcional
- deve permitir registrar, buscar, alterar mensagens publicadas pelo usuario
##### Requisito Técnico
- Modelo Mensagem:
| campo | tipo | obrigatório | descrição |
| -------- | -------------- | ----------- | ------------------------- |
| id | UUID | PK | identificador da mensagem |
| usuario | string(8, 20) | sim | nome do usuário |
| conteudo | string(1, 150) | sim | conteúdo da mensagem |
| gostei | integer | não | contador de gostei |## ramos/branchs do projeto
- **aula_02**: estrutura inicial do projeto e testes unitários
- **aula_03**: testes integrados na camada do repositório
- **aula_04**: testes unitários e integrados na camada de apresentação
- **aula_05**: testes de sistema e comportamento
- **aula_06**: aplicando integração contínua e boas práticas